加入收藏 | 设为首页 | 会员中心 | 我要投稿 站长网 (https://www.0563zz.com/)- 存储数据、关系型数据库、网络、视频终端、媒体处理!
当前位置: 首页 > 站长学院 > MsSql教程 > 正文

PHP+MSSQL高效存储与触发器实战

发布时间:2026-06-29 08:12:57 所属栏目:MsSql教程 来源:DaWei
导读:  在现代Web应用开发中,PHP与MSSQL的组合为数据处理提供了稳定且高效的解决方案。当需要处理大量结构化数据时,利用PHP连接MSSQL数据库并实现高效存储,是提升系统性能的关键步骤。通过使用PDO或SQL Server扩展,

  在现代Web应用开发中,PHP与MSSQL的组合为数据处理提供了稳定且高效的解决方案。当需要处理大量结构化数据时,利用PHP连接MSSQL数据库并实现高效存储,是提升系统性能的关键步骤。通过使用PDO或SQL Server扩展,开发者可以建立稳定的数据库连接,确保数据读写过程的可靠性与安全性。


  在数据存储层面,合理设计表结构是基础。例如,对频繁查询的字段建立索引,避免全表扫描带来的性能损耗。同时,使用预处理语句(Prepared Statements)可有效防止SQL注入攻击,提升系统安全性和执行效率。结合事务机制,能够在多步操作中保证数据一致性,尤其适用于订单、支付等关键业务场景。


  触发器(Trigger)是MSSQL中强大的自动化工具。它能在INSERT、UPDATE或DELETE操作发生时自动执行特定逻辑。例如,在用户表更新时,可通过触发器同步更新审计日志表,记录操作时间、操作人及变更内容,实现数据变更的可追溯性。


  实际应用中,可定义一个“订单状态变更”触发器:当订单状态从“待支付”变为“已支付”时,自动触发库存扣减逻辑,并向消息队列推送通知,确保前后端数据实时同步。这类操作无需在PHP代码中重复编写,极大简化了业务逻辑。


2026AI模拟图像,仅供参考

  为提升整体效率,建议将频繁调用的触发器逻辑优化为轻量级存储过程,并通过参数传递数据,减少网络往返开销。同时,定期监控触发器执行情况,避免因死循环或资源争用导致数据库性能下降。


  本站观点,结合PHP的灵活控制能力与MSSQL触发器的自动化特性,能够构建出既安全又高效的后台数据处理系统。合理运用这些技术,不仅提升开发效率,也增强了系统的可维护性与稳定性。

(编辑:站长网)

【声明】本站内容均来自网络,其相关言论仅代表作者个人观点,不代表本站立场。若无意侵犯到您的权利,请及时与联系站长删除相关内容!

    推荐文章